[quote=Anonymous]Your father has asked that you respect the boundary your stepmother has put in place. You don't want to, you want her to deal with you on your terms. When someone places a hard no-contact boundary, STOP. Respect that. Each time you try to push through it, you're making things worse. Perhaps one day your stepmother will take a tentative step towards reestablishing a relationship with you. Maybe she won't. But it takes two people to have a relationship and she has made it abundantly clear she doesn't want one with you at this time.[/quote]
